2. Adobe Express (Generate Video by Firefly)

Adobe Express leverages the power of its Firefly AI model to integrate text-to-video generation directly into a user-friendly, template-driven content creation platform. It stands out by making AI video generation a seamless part of a larger marketing or social media workflow, rather than an isolated tool. This makes it an excellent choice for creators and marketers already invested in the Adobe ecosystem or those needing an all-in-one solution for creating polished social content quickly.

Adobe Express (Generate Video by Firefly)

The platform’s key advantage is its integration. You can generate a short AI clip and immediately add text overlays, brand assets from your Creative Cloud Libraries, and music from the Adobe Stock library without leaving the app. For professionals, the workflow can continue into Adobe Premiere Pro for more advanced editing, making Express a powerful starting point for complex projects.

Key Features & Analysis

  • Generation Model: Powered by Adobe Firefly, trained on licensed content to be commercially safe. This provides a strong legal and ethical foundation for brand use.
  • Core AI Tools: Includes text-to-video (currently in public beta), AI-powered background removal, and Adobe's renowned one-click Speech Enhancement tool.
  • Workflow Integration: Offers a tight handoff to Creative Cloud apps like Premiere Pro and Photoshop. Brand kits, libraries, and templates sync across the ecosystem.
  • Pricing: A free plan offers limited access. The Premium plan ($9.99/month) includes more monthly "Generative Credits," which are consumed for AI generations.

Our Take: Adobe Express is the best AI video maker for brand-conscious marketers and creators who need a commercially safe, integrated tool. While its text-to-video feature is still developing and has short clip length limits, its strength lies in the combination of AI generation with a robust suite of established design and editing tools.

3. Runway

Runway is a comprehensive AI-first video platform that appeals to creators who demand granular control over the generative process. It offers a suite of advanced models, including the latest Gen-3 Alpha, alongside a full-featured online video editor. This combination makes Runway a powerful sandbox for artists, filmmakers, and creative agencies looking to push the boundaries of AI-generated content beyond simple text prompts, making it a top contender for the best AI video maker available.

Runway

The platform’s key advantage is its suite of generative tools and controls. Users can generate from text, images, or even existing video clips, and then refine their creations with tools like Motion Brush, Camera Controls, and Director Mode. The transparent, per-second credit system provides clear cost expectations, while extensive learning resources via Runway Academy help users master its advanced features for professional-level output.

Key Features & Analysis

  • Generation Model: Access to multiple models, including the cutting-edge Gen-3 Alpha for highly detailed and coherent video, plus Gen-2 for different styles.
  • Core AI Tools: Includes text-to-video, image-to-video, and video-to-video generation. Advanced features include 4K upscaling, keyframe controls for motion, and AI training for custom styles on higher-tier plans.
  • Workflow Integration: Features a built-in multi-track video editor, allowing users to assemble, edit, and export their generated clips without leaving the platform.
  • Pricing: A free plan offers limited credits. Paid plans start with the Standard plan ($12/user/month) providing more credits, with Pro and Unlimited tiers offering advanced features and larger credit pools.

Our Take: Runway is the best AI video maker for creative professionals and artists who want maximum control over the generative process. Its combination of multiple advanced models, director-level controls, and an integrated editor creates a robust end-to-end workflow for producing cinematic and artistic AI video.

4. Luma AI – Dream Machine

Luma AI’s Dream Machine has rapidly emerged as a powerful text-to-video and image-to-video generator, gaining attention for its ability to produce clips with remarkably realistic motion and fluid character consistency. It excels at turning static ideas into dynamic, short-form video content, making it a strong contender for creators focused on high-quality b-roll, conceptual animations, or surreal visual storytelling without complex post-production.

The platform is accessible via web and iOS, prioritizing speed and output quality over an extensive suite of in-app editing tools. Dream Machine is particularly effective for generating a high volume of short, 5-second clips for ideation or for artists and designers who want to animate their still images with cinematic flair. Paid tiers unlock commercial rights and higher resolution outputs, positioning it as a viable tool for professional workflows.

Key Features & Analysis

  • Generation Model: Powered by Luma's proprietary Ray series models, which are trained for high-fidelity motion and object physics.
  • Core AI Tools: Includes text-to-video and image-to-video generation. Paid plans offer features like HDR output and 4K up-resolution for professional-grade quality.
  • Workflow Integration: Functions as a standalone generation tool. The primary workflow involves generating clips and downloading them for use in external video editing software.
  • Pricing: A free plan provides 30 monthly generations with watermarks and for non-commercial use. Paid plans start at $29.99/month, offering more credits, commercial rights, and higher quality outputs.

Our Take: Luma AI’s Dream Machine is the best AI video maker for users who prioritize realistic motion and rapid generation of short, high-quality clips. While its short duration and lack of integrated editing tools limit its use for long-form content, its model quality and speed make it an exceptional choice for creating b-roll, animating still images, and prototyping visual concepts quickly.

5. Synthesia

Synthesia is a leading AI video creation platform focused on generating professional, avatar-led videos for corporate training, internal communications, and product explainers. Instead of text-to-video scene generation, its strength lies in converting scripts into polished presentations delivered by photorealistic AI avatars. This makes it an ideal solution for businesses looking to scale video production for learning and development or marketing without the costs of filming.

Synthesia

The platform is purpose-built for enterprise and team workflows, offering features like SCORM export for Learning Management Systems (LMS), API access, and robust collaboration tools. Its AI-powered dubbing and translation features are a significant advantage for global companies, allowing one video to be localized into dozens of languages with just a few clicks, ensuring consistent messaging across different regions.

Key Features & Analysis

  • Generation Model: Utilizes a proprietary model for creating realistic AI avatars and synthesizing human-like speech from text. It does not generate video scenes from prompts.
  • Core AI Tools: Features over 200 stock AI avatars, custom avatar creation, AI script generation, and powerful text-to-speech with AI-powered translation and voice cloning into over 130 languages.
  • Workflow Integration: Designed for business use with features like SCORM export, API access, and integrations with tools like PowerPoint and various content management systems.
  • Pricing: The Personal plan starts at $22/month for 10 minutes of video. The Creator and Enterprise plans offer more minutes, custom avatars, and advanced business features, with custom pricing for enterprise needs.

Our Take: Synthesia is the best AI video maker for corporate training and multilingual business communications. While its avatar-centric approach may not suit creative or cinematic projects, its efficiency, scalability, and localization features are unparalleled for creating consistent, on-brand instructional and informational content at scale.

6. InVideo AI

InVideo AI excels at transforming scripts into polished videos in minutes, making it a go-to tool for marketers and creators focused on speed and efficiency. Instead of focusing on text-to-video clip generation, its AI streamlines the entire production workflow. You provide a script or a topic, and the AI assembles a complete video with relevant stock footage, voiceovers, text overlays, and transitions, which can then be fine-tuned in a traditional timeline editor.

InVideo AI

This workflow-based approach makes it ideal for producing content like social media ads, explainer videos, and YouTube listicles at scale. While it may lack the advanced generative capabilities of other platforms, its strength lies in leveraging AI to intelligently assemble existing assets into a coherent and professional-looking final product with minimal manual effort.

Key Features & Analysis

  • Generation Model: Utilizes AI for script-to-video assembly, not direct video generation. It intelligently selects clips from a vast library of stock media to match the script's content.
  • Core AI Tools: Includes AI script generation, automated scene creation, realistic text-to-speech voiceovers in multiple languages, and smart asset selection.
  • Workflow Integration: Offers a self-contained, browser-based editor with a massive template library. It’s designed for a quick start-to-finish process for social media formats.
  • Pricing: A generous free plan allows users to export videos with an InVideo watermark. Paid plans start at $20/month (billed annually) for watermark-free exports and premium stock media access.

Our Take: InVideo AI is the best AI video maker for creators and marketers who prioritize workflow automation and speed over generative novelty. It's an exceptionally fast tool for turning scripts into engaging social media content, listicles, and promotional videos using high-quality stock assets.

7. Descript

Descript takes a unique, transcript-first approach to video production, positioning itself as an AI-powered audio and video editor rather than a generative tool. It shines by letting you edit complex video and audio projects simply by editing a text document. This makes it an incredibly efficient tool for creators focused on dialogue-heavy content like podcasts, online courses, product demos, and corporate training materials.

Descript

The platform’s core strength is its powerful AI assistant, "Underlord," which automates tedious editing tasks. You can remove filler words ("um," "uh") with a single click, automatically generate accurate subtitles, and even clone your own voice using the "Overdub" feature to correct mistakes without re-recording. This workflow-centric design drastically cuts down editing time for talk-first video content.

Key Features & Analysis

  • Generation Model: Utilizes a suite of proprietary AI models focused on workflow enhancement, not cinematic generation. This includes transcription, voice cloning (Overdub), and automated editing tasks.
  • Core AI Tools: Features transcript-based video editing, Overdub (text-to-speech voice cloning), automatic filler word removal, studio-quality sound enhancement, and an AI co-editor for summarizing and finding highlights.
  • Workflow Integration: Offers robust team collaboration features, screen recording, and integrations with other platforms. It's built as an end-to-end production tool for spoken-word content.
  • Pricing: Provides a free plan with basic features. Paid plans start with the Creator tier ($12/month) and Pro tier ($24/month), offering more transcription hours, 4K export, and advanced AI features.

Our Take: Descript is the best AI video maker for podcasters, educators, and marketers creating dialogue-driven content. Its genius lies in transforming the tedious process of video editing into a simple word-processing task. While it's not a text-to-video generator for creating cinematic scenes, its AI-powered workflow tools are revolutionary for anyone who works with spoken audio and video.

8. Canva

Canva integrates AI video tools directly into its world-renowned, all-in-one design platform, making it a go-to for teams that need to produce branded content at scale. Rather than being a standalone generator, Canva's "Magic Media" feature allows users to create short AI video clips from text prompts within its familiar drag-and-drop editor. This approach is ideal for small businesses, social media managers, and marketing teams who prioritize speed, brand consistency, and access to a massive library of templates and stock assets.

Canva

The platform’s core strength is its unified workflow. A user can generate an AI clip, add it to a social media template, apply brand colors and fonts from their Brand Kit, add animated text, and resize the entire project for different platforms in just a few clicks. This seamless process eliminates the need to jump between multiple applications, streamlining content creation for fast-paced environments.

Key Features & Analysis

  • Generation Model: Canva's "Magic Media" feature includes a text-to-video generator. Its model is designed for ease of use and integration rather than photorealistic, cinematic output.
  • Core AI Tools: Includes text-to-video clip generation, Magic Edit for objects, Magic Design for automated template creation, and AI-powered background removal.
  • Workflow Integration: Features a comprehensive suite of design tools, including a massive template library, stock photos/videos, brand kits, and powerful team collaboration features.
  • Pricing: A free plan offers limited AI generations. Paid plans (Pro from $14.99/month, Teams from $29.99/month for 5 people) provide more "credits" for AI features. Discounts are often available for nonprofits and educational institutions.

Our Take: Canva is the best AI video maker for marketing teams and non-designers who need an incredibly approachable, all-in-one solution. While its AI-generated clips are basic compared to dedicated models, their integration into Canva's powerful design ecosystem makes creating polished, on-brand social media content faster than almost any other tool.

9. Microsoft Clipchamp

Microsoft Clipchamp positions itself as a user-friendly, accessible video editor deeply integrated into the Windows and Microsoft 365 ecosystem. While not a dedicated text-to-video generator like some rivals, it uses AI to simplify the editing process through features like auto-composition and text-to-speech. This makes it an excellent choice for beginners, students, and business users needing to quickly assemble polished videos for presentations, social media, or internal communications without a steep learning curve.

Microsoft Clipchamp

The platform's main advantage is its convenience, especially for Windows 11 users where it comes pre-installed. Its generous free tier, which includes watermark-free exports up to 1080p, is a significant draw. Rather than focusing on generating novel clips from text, Clipchamp uses AI to assist traditional editing workflows, making it a practical tool for everyday video creation tasks.

Key Features & Analysis

  • Generation Model: Utilizes AI for assistive features rather than generative video. This includes auto-composition, which analyzes your clips and suggests edits, and AI-powered text-to-speech with various voice options.
  • Core AI Tools: Key features are the auto-compose tool, text-to-speech narration, and an automatic subtitle generator. It also offers a simple background remover for green screen effects.
  • Workflow Integration: Seamlessly integrated with Windows 11 and Microsoft 365. You can easily import files from OneDrive, and the editor is available as a web app and a desktop application.
  • Pricing: A robust free plan offers 1080p exports without watermarks. The Premium plan (part of Microsoft 365 subscriptions) unlocks premium stock assets, brand kits, and content backup.

Our Take: Clipchamp is the best AI video maker for Windows users and beginners who need a simple, free, and effective tool for basic video editing. Its AI features are designed to speed up the process rather than create from scratch, making it a highly practical choice for quick projects, school assignments, or corporate videos.

11. Kapwing

Kapwing is a collaborative, browser-based video editing suite supercharged with AI tools designed for modern content creators and marketing teams. It excels at repurposing and localization workflows, offering a comprehensive toolkit that goes beyond simple generation. Instead of focusing solely on text-to-video, Kapwing positions itself as a central hub for creating, subtitling, translating, and reformatting video content for multiple platforms efficiently.

Kapwing

The platform’s strength lies in its team-oriented features and content-repurposing tools. A team can upload a long-form video, and Kapwing's AI can automatically find the most engaging clips, generate accurate subtitles, translate them into multiple languages, and reformat the video for TikTok, Reels, or YouTube Shorts. This makes it an invaluable tool for brands aiming to maximize their content's reach across different regions and platforms.

Key Features & Analysis

  • Core AI Tools: Features include an AI clip maker, script-to-video, AI-powered dubbing and translation, and "Smart Cut," which automatically removes silences. The auto-subtitling tool is exceptionally accurate.
  • Workflow Integration: As a browser-based platform, it emphasizes collaboration through shared workspaces, comments, and brand kits, allowing teams to maintain consistency without installing software.
  • Content Repurposing: The Repurpose Studio is a standout feature, enabling one-click resizing and reframing of videos for various social media aspect ratios.
  • Pricing: Offers a free plan with watermarked exports capped at 720p. The Pro plan ($16/month billed annually) removes watermarks, adds 4K export, and provides more AI credits.

Our Take: Kapwing is the best AI video maker for teams focused on content repurposing and localization. Its powerful subtitling, translation, and smart editing tools streamline the process of adapting a single video for a global, multi-platform audience. While heavy AI use can deplete credits on lower tiers, its collaborative suite is a major productivity booster.
